Over the year ending March 2012, an additional 1.5 million households moved into rental housing, a 4 percent increase in a single year.
Rental vacancy rates have dropped roughly 2 percentage points over the past two years.
While nominal rents rose (2 to 4 percent) during the year ending March 2012, average rent on an inflation-adjusted basis remained below where it had been for much of the decade prior to the Great Recession.June 2012 U.S. Economic And Housing Market Outlook - MarketWatch
